Write and equation for (-1,2) and (0,0)
Respuesta :
Аноним
Аноним
15-11-2016
Since the slope is -2 because
x1: -1 x2: 0
y1: 2 y2: 0
y2-y1/x2-x1 = slope (0-2/0+1= -2/1 = -2)
You would havr to change it into point slope form so it would look like this
Y-2 = -2(x+1)
y-2 = -2x -2
+2 +2
y = -2x + 0
